Lifesaving surgical approaches for severe penetrating knife injury to the neck
Abstract Background Penetrating neck injuries are rare and require urgent surgical intervention to prevent life-threatening complications. This report highlights a unique case involving complex surgical repair of tracheal, esophageal, and vascular injuries following a homicidal assault, emphasizing...
